当前位置:首页 » 安卓系统 » 安卓如何修改mac

安卓如何修改mac

发布时间: 2022-04-20 03:21:58

1. 安卓 系统 很多软件都是读取wifi Mac地址 进行验证的 请问要怎么更改Mac地址呢

  1. 右击桌面网上邻居,点“属性”,找到本地连接适配器页面

  2. 选择要修改适配器本地连接,右击本地连接,点“属性”

  3. 在弹出的窗口中找到“配置”按钮,点击进去

  4. 在“高级”选项卡的“属性”框中选中“本地管理的地址”,这个地方注意了,不同网卡适配器“属性”框内名字不相同,这里是“本地管理的地址”,其它网卡适配器有可能是英文的“Locally Administered Address”或“Network Address (MAC)”,或者是其它类似的中英文描述,注意识别。

5.然后在属性框右边选择“值”,输入我们需要的MAC地址值:000000000001。更改MAC地址会导致短时间丢失连接,更改成功后会自动恢复连接。这样MAC地址已经成功更改,如要恢复默认的MAC地址,可选择“不存在”默认值即可。

2. 安卓一键修改mac无需root

安卓不可以修改Mac,一只蚂蚁是做不到让一头大象为了它改变生活方式的一样。

3. 如何更改或增添安卓手机的mac地址

android 是linux内核,linux中mac地址是保存在/etc/init.d/networ 文件中的
但是在android中mac地址是直接写在硬件中的,需要通过API 才能获取

1、Android 获取本机Mac 地址方法:
需要在AndroidManifest.xml文件中添加权限:
<uses-permission android:name="android.permission.ACCESS_WIFI_STATE" />
public String getLocalMacAddress() {
WifiManager wifi = (WifiManager) getSystemService(Context.WIFI_SERVICE);
WifiInfo info = wifi.getConnectionInfo();
return info.getMacAddress();
}

2、Android 获取本机IP地址方法:
public String getLocalIpAddress() {
try {
for (Enumeration<NetworkInterface> en = NetworkInterface
.getNetworkInterfaces(); en.hasMoreElements();) {
NetworkInterface intf = en.nextElement();
for (Enumeration<InetAddress> enumIpAddr = intf
.getInetAddresses(); enumIpAddr.hasMoreElements();) {
InetAddress inetAddress = enumIpAddr.nextElement();
if (!inetAddress.isLoopbackAddress()) {
return inetAddress.getHostAddress().toString();
}
}
}
} catch (SocketException ex) {
Log.e("WifiPreference IpAddress", ex.toString());
}
return null;
}

4. 怎么修改手机MAC地址

如需查看手机WLAN MAC地址,请操作:设置-关于手机(关于设备)-状态-WLAN MAC地址。

5. android系统如何修改成想要的mac地址格式

android 是Linux内核,linux中mac地址是保存在/etc/init.d/networ 文件中的,mac地址可以用:连接,也可以用-连接。但是在android中mac地址是直接写在硬件中的,需要通过API 才能获取1、Android 获取本机Mac 地址方法:需要在AndroidManifest.xml文件中添加权限: public String getLocalMacAddress() { WifiManager wifi = (WifiManager) getSystemService(Context.WIFI_SERVICE); WifiInfo info = wifi.getConnectionInfo(); return info.getMacAddress(); } 2、Android 获取本机IP地址方法:public String getLocalIpAddress() {try {for (Enumeration en = NetworkInterface.getNetworkInterfaces(); en.hasMoreElements();) {NetworkInterface intf = en.nextElement();for (Enumeration enumIpAddr = intf.getInetAddresses(); enumIpAddr.hasMoreElements();) {InetAddress inetAddress = enumIpAddr.nextElement();if (!inetAddress.isLoopbackAddress()) {return inetAddress.getHostAddress().toString();}}}} catch (SocketException ex) {Log.e("WifiPreference IpAddress", ex.toString());}return null;}

6. 谁能教我怎么修改安卓手机得的mac啊

system/etc/firmware/ti-connectivity
/wl1271-nvs.bin,
复制备份这个东西,
用十六进制文本编辑器打开这个文件,找到你原先的Mac地址,修改,保存,覆盖,重启即可。

7. 怎么改手机MAC地址

1.最简单的方法就是利用傻瓜式的软件修改了,不过首先你需要将手机ROOT/越狱。对于安卓手机来说,在ROOT之后,可以首先尝试MacAddress这款软件。这款软件的使用方法比较简单,只要你的手机成功ROOT,安装软件后即可输入想要更改的MAC地址,不过该软件的弊端是无法支持所有设备,一些设备在使用这种修改方法后无法修改成功。

2.首先还是要保证你的手机ROOT成功了,然后就需要下载手机端的文件管理器,可以选择RE或者ES浏览器,通用方法是找到/etc/firmware/nvram.txt文件,备份后以文本方式打开nvram.txt,找到以下段落:

#macaddr=00:11:22:33:44:55

nocrc=1

#nvram_override=1

修改为:

macaddr=00:11:22:33:44:55

nocrc=1

nvram_override=1

3.注意,这里需要把#去掉才能修改成功,00:11:22:33:44:55部分修改为你需要的地址。保存后 开关 一次Wi-Fi,新的MAC地址就生效了。大家可以去关于手机中验证MAC地址是否更改正确。

4.这种方法适用于大部分安卓4.0以上的设备,不过由于安卓手机系统太过庞杂,不同安卓版本可能需要编辑的文件也不一样,比如某些安卓4.1的设备的文件就在/etc/wifi/下,如果大家没有在文中位置找到相应的文件,可以去自己手机型号的论坛查询对应的文件。

5.至于iOS设备,修改的方法相对固定一些,越狱后可以在cydia中搜索MOBILE TERMINAL插件,安装后打开执行以下指令:

6.输入命令:su 回车

接着输入密码:alpine 回车 (此处为默认用户密码,可以进行更改,在输入时可能不会及时显示字符,不过不要担心,确认成功输入后回车即可)

接着输入:nvram wifiaddr=XX:XX:XX:XX:XX:XX (nvram wifiaddr=就是修改MAC地址的命令,XX:XX:XX:XX:XX:XX为新的MAC地址,输入后直接按回车,退出Terminal,并重启手机即可。

7.值得说明的是,这种方法只适用于iOS 5.1.1以上的版本,其他低版本的机器要连接iTunes激活、如果连接iTunes无法识别的话那就删除位于/var/mobile/Media目录下的iTunes_Control文件夹、删除完iTunes_Control目录后、重新开启iTunes MOBILE TERMINAL即可。

8. 如果更改安卓手机的mac地址

MAC地址是硬件地址,无法更改的。

Android查看MAC地址的方式:

  1. 在主屏幕上轻按“设置”按钮。或者,按下物理按钮“Menu”,选择“设置”。

  2. 在设置的列表下,轻按选择“关于本机”按钮。

  3. 然后,轻按“状态消息”按钮。

  4. 在状态中查看“Wi-Fi MAC 地址”。


同时也可在【WLAN】下查看MAC地址。

  1. 同样打开手机——【设置】——【无线网络】——【WLAN】

  2. 进入WLAN页面后,触摸手机【菜单键】选择——【高级】

  3. 在WLAN高级设置界面也可查看到MAC地址窜号。

9. 安卓手机怎么改MAC地址Android如何修改MAC地址

一. /system/etc/firmware/nvram.txt 或者是 /system/etc/wifi/nvram.txt
二. 需要安装 AndroidSDK 和 FASTBOOT/adb 的驱动程序。
1)打开一个新的命令窗口。
2)Type
3)输入cd \
4) 输入cd AndroidSDK\tools
5) 打开手机进入Fastboot
astboot OEM rebootRUU
6)在您的手机会重新启动,

type:FASTBOOT OEM emapiWlanMac
你会得到这样东西:
... INFONotice: This MAC address takes effect only
when your platfor
INFOm is EEPRON-less configuration. Please use (emapiTest) to v
INFOerify it !
INFO0x00000000
INFO0x000000DE
INFO0x000000AD
INFO0x000000BE
INFO0x000000EF
INFO0x00000000
INFO-eMapiWlanMacCommand, status = 1
OKAY [ 0.025s]
finished. total time: 0.026s

请注意您的MAC地址(中强调的部分 - 这个MAC地址是00: DE:AD:BE:EF:00)。
7)现在,输入命令来设置新的MAC地址(MAC地址应该用空格代替':'):
fastboot oem emapiWlanMac 00 01 02 03 04 05
MAC地址修改成了00:01:02:03:04:05。
8)完成!输入重新启动:
fastboot oem boot
这样mac地址就改好了

热点内容
当前urlphp 发布:2025-07-02 02:49:17 浏览:931
哪里学习编程 发布:2025-07-02 02:33:51 浏览:161
我的世界商店服务器刷钱 发布:2025-07-02 02:28:55 浏览:149
知道ip怎么入侵服务器啊 发布:2025-07-02 02:13:17 浏览:144
c语言手机编译 发布:2025-07-02 02:12:33 浏览:734
安卓快充协议是什么意思 发布:2025-07-02 02:07:00 浏览:897
androidbutton颜色设置 发布:2025-07-02 01:41:28 浏览:270
sqlserver2008添加数据 发布:2025-07-02 01:41:28 浏览:250
胶水解压 发布:2025-07-02 01:40:49 浏览:123
源码瀑布流 发布:2025-07-02 01:40:49 浏览:354